Osteoarthritis
Osteoarthritis (OA) is a degenerative joint disease characterized by the breakdown of joint cartilage and underlying bone, leading to symptoms like joint pain, stiffness, swelling, and decreased range of motion, most commonly affecting the fingers, thumbs, knees, hips, neck, and lower back. Risk factors include joint injury, obesity, aging, misaligned joints, and family history, with symptoms typically progressing slowly and potentially interfering with daily activities.
